(TAYD) reported first-quarter fiscal 2026 earnings per share of $0.79, modestly sur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.7854, resulting in a reported surprise of 0.59. Revenue figures were not disclosed for the period, and the company did not provide year-over-year growth comparisons. In after-market trading, shares rose 3.19%, reflecting a measured positive reaction from investors.

Management attributed the earnings beat to disciplined cost controls and efficient manufacturing execution during the quarter. While top-line revenue data was not released, the company highlighted steady order flow from its core industrial and defense product lines. Segment performance remained stable, with particular strength in the company’s precision shock and vibration control solutions. Margins appeared to benefit from favorable product mix and lower input costs, though no specific profitability metrics were provided. Management noted that ongoing investments in production capacity and process automation are helping to maintain operational leverage. The strong EPS figure suggests that the company was able to protect profitability despite any potential volume fluctuations. Taylor Devices continues to focus on niche, high-value applications where it holds competitive advantages, which may have supported pricing power during the quarter. No major one-time items were cited, implying the beat was driven by core business fundamentals.

The company expects sustained demand from defense and heavy industrial customers, which could help support backlog levels. However, management acknowledged potential headwinds, including supply chain volatility and rising labor costs, which may pressure margins in coming quarters. Strategic priorities remain centered on expanding capacity in existing facilities and pursuing targeted research and development for new product applications. Taylor Devices may also continue to evaluate strategic acquisitions to broaden its technological capabilities, though no specific targets were named. The company anticipates that current capital allocation will prioritize organic growth initiatives over share buybacks or dividends in the near term. Risk factors include the cyclical nature of its end markets and any potential slowdown in government spending. No formal fiscal 2026 revenue or EPS guidance was provided, leaving investors to rely on management’s qualitative outlook.

The 3.19% upward movement in TAYD's stock suggests a modest but positive market response to the earnings beat and operational stability. Broader analyst commentary has been cautiously constructive, noting that while the EPS surprise of 0.59 was small in absolute terms, it reinforces confidence in management’s ability to navigate a challenging environment. Some analysts have highlighted the lack of revenue disclosure as a limiting factor for deeper valuation analysis. Going forward, investors will likely focus on order intake trends, margin sustainability, and any future updates on revenue performance. Key catalysts to watch include the release of quarterly backlog data, any new defense contracts, and commentary on capital allocation during the next earnings call. Given the absence of formal guidance, the market may remain range-bound until clearer indicators emerge. The stock’s current valuation may already reflect the cautious outlook, making future quarterly results critical for determining direction.
